How they compare

Syrian Arab Republic currently reports 0.0292 units per US$ of GDP against 0.0288 units per US$ of GDP in Ecuador, a difference of 0.0004 units per US$ of GDP.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Ecuador ahead.

Ecuador ranks 113th and Syrian Arab Republic ranks 111th of 170 countries.

Syrian Arab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
